Write once read many

WORM is an acronym for "write once read many " or " write once read multiple" (English " write once, read many "). She describes precautions in Information Technology, which exclude the delete, overwrite and modify data permanently on a storage medium. The data storage that are used can be described only read and continued until their capacity.

History and definition

The term WORM was primarily used in conjunction with optical storage media and tape storage. Through the further development, the term now on all storage media that does not leave the information be changed or deleted.

In a broader sense WORM also appears in connection with archiving programs that reach through the type of formatting a Einmalbeschreibbarkeit Connected media.

Not all fall under WORM solutions of the temporary write protection or encryption.

A distinction is made in the narrow sense: Hardware - WORM and WORM systemic. While in the former, the WORM property generated by irreversible physical changes in the storage medium, the deletion protection results in the second from the interaction of storage processor / controller and the memory medium. In the other version, software - WORM be added as a third category.

WORM Hardware

From hardware WORM (also: TrueWORM called ) is when the write-once property is given physically. In this case, either recesses or blisters are generated in the interior of the medium by a laser beam. These can not be changed at a later point in time.

Unlike a multi-session CD WORM memory can be like an early CD -R to no deletion of data. Originally, the term referred to specific WORM media and drives. This media is in a protective case and were first with 14 ", 12", 8 ", 5 1/ 4" and 3 1/2 " Diameter available. In 2006, only played by the media with 5 1/ 4" in diameter, a role. In electronic archive systems since 2006 are mostly modern TrueWORM in UDO or PDD technology used.

TrueWORM systems based on rotating media have the problem of low disk space, so holds a current UDO2 medium only 60 GB, while archiving systems with software WORM are also available in the TB area.

Systemic WORM

In the systemic WORM unique writability is achieved either via the addressing or management by the internal processor / controller.

In the form of a WORM USB sticks the unique writability is determined by the internal controller of the USB sticks for example, when SECUMEM memory.

The Magneto Optical Disk is available with drives with WORM properties.

Content Addressed Storage (CAS ) is a technique which produces the write-once property of the software. CAS is mostly sold as a dedicated hard disk system. Examples are the Centera EMC, Caringo, Silent Cubes or iTernity iCAS.

Software WORM

WORM but can also be the pure software functionality in a network storage system, as it is with SnapLock or gray Data AG offered for example by NetApp with FileLock. In this case we speak of software WORM (also: SoftWORM called ).

It is, for example, special magnetic tapes ( WORM tape ) is possible with the corresponding drives. Come hard disk drives to use as is often spoken of WORM raid.

A special form of WORM sealing systems used by FAST LTA. As media are used here as in SoftWORM commercial hard disk, WORM functionality is provided by a external hard drive controller. This controller distributes data evenly across the hard drives connected and writes the data purely linear. Commands to delete or overwrite does not know this controller. Since the special file system is also firmly anchored in the controller, the disks can not be manipulated by connecting it to another hard drive or RAID controller.

Use and safety

Memory as the CD - R are in the age of server-based storage and cloud solutions as a carrier of digital information out of fashion.

A major application of WORM media, however, is the digital archiving. These come with large amounts of unchanging documents and records used. They are increasingly gaining in importance again since the legislature that allows for financial management and compliance regulations digital documents stored in immutable way, or even prescribe. Here comes the particular GDPdU to bear. But regulations such as SOX, Basel II and others rely on the immutability of stored documents.

When using all WORM systems should however be noted that only a comprehensive solution, including a document management and safe operation, can meet the legal information. The use of WORM media, is not sufficient. Content and storage data can be usually easily manipulate before storing. Remedy the integration in holistic archiving systems and volumes with its own timer and use monitoring such as the SECUMEM memory.

Particularly in software WORM, but also in systemic WORM, immutability can not be fully demonstrated. Programming errors resulting vulnerabilities in software or hardware can be exploited to bypass the overwrite protection.
